Reminder, there are Island Rail 1-day or 2-day tickets sold in Isahaya (Adult 3500 / Child 1750 yen, including trains and cars). If you go directly to the hotel from Isahaya, it is recommended to take a bus directly in Isahaya , About 50 minutes. If you want to take a small yellow train deliberately, you must get to the main station Shimabara, change the bus in the direction of Unzen at the gate, and it will take 2 hours to get to the hotel.
